Industries Prone to Social Engineering Attacks
Financial Services: A Prime Target
The financial services industry stands out as a prime target for social engineering attacks. Cybercriminals often target banking institutions, investment firms, and financial professionals, exploiting the high-stakes nature of financial transactions and the wealth of sensitive data accessible within these sectors. Phishing attempts, pretexting, and impersonation tactics are frequently deployed to compromise accounts and gain illicit access to financial assets.
Healthcare: Exploiting Sensitive Information
The healthcare industry, with its treasure trove of sensitive patient information, is another focal point for social engineering attacks. The allure of valuable medical records, personally identifiable information (PII), and the potential for ransom demands make healthcare organisations susceptible to tactics such as phishing, impersonation, and pretexting. The urgency associated with healthcare situations adds an additional layer of vulnerability.
Technology and IT: Targeting the Gatekeepers
Given their role as gatekeepers of digital infrastructure, technology and IT companies face heightened susceptibility to social engineering attacks. Cybercriminals may impersonate IT personnel, exploit vulnerabilities in software, or use sophisticated phishing techniques to gain access to critical systems and sensitive data. The interconnected nature of the technology sector amplifies the potential impact of successful social engineering attacks.
Manufacturing and Critical Infrastructure: Disrupting Operations
Industries involved in manufacturing and critical infrastructure are not immune to the threats posed by social engineering. Attackers may seek to disrupt operations, compromise supply chains, or gain access to industrial control systems. Social engineering tactics targeting employees involved in production processes, logistics, or infrastructure management can have cascading effects on these sectors.
Government and Defence: Strategic Targets
Government agencies and defence organisations are strategic targets for social engineering attacks. The potential for accessing classified information, intelligence, or disrupting national security makes these sectors susceptible to sophisticated social engineering tactics. Impersonation, pretexting, and spear phishing are often employed to compromise the integrity of government and defence systems.
Factors Influencing Vulnerability
The Human Factor
The susceptibility of industries to social engineering attacks often boils down to the human factor. Regardless of the sector, individuals within organisations remain the primary targets. Human tendencies to trust, comply with authority, or act impulsively in urgent situations create vulnerabilities that attackers exploit. Industries with a culture of openness, a lack of cybersecurity awareness, or less stringent verification protocols may face heightened risks.
Regulatory Compliance
Industries subject to stringent regulatory compliance requirements, such as finance and healthcare, may be more attuned to the importance of cybersecurity. However, the very nature of compliance-focused activities, which can involve frequent interactions and communications, may inadvertently create opportunities for attackers to exploit individuals within these sectors.
Mitigating Industry-Specific Risks
Tailoring Defence Strategies
Mitigating industry-specific risks associated with social engineering attacks requires a tailored approach. Organisations within vulnerable sectors should prioritise cybersecurity awareness and training programs that address the unique threats prevalent in their industry. Implementing robust verification protocols, regular security audits, and cultivating a culture of vigilance contribute to overall resilience.
Collaboration and Information Sharing
Collaboration and information sharing among organisations within a specific industry enhance collective defence efforts. Establishing industry-specific threat intelligence sharing platforms enables companies to stay informed about emerging social engineering tactics, learn from each other’s experiences, and collectively fortify their defences against shared threats.
